Top 6 Best Used Bookstores Near Tampa

1. Mojo Books & Records

Mojo Books & Records is a fun, cozy, and quirky spot in Tampa for book and music lovers alike. Near the University of South Florida, this indie bookstore has been a local favorite since 2007. They have a huge selection of used books, from fiction to sci-fi, and a great selection of vinyl records. You can sip on coffee or tea at their café while browsing the shelves. Mojo also hosts live music and book events, so it’s a great place to hang out. They buy and trade books and records, so you can bring your old stuff to swap. Check out their website to browse their online store or check event schedules.

Website: Mojo Books & Records

2. The Book Rescuers

The Book Rescuers in Pinellas Park is a giant, inexpensive, and awesome warehouse for book lovers. With over 40,000 books on more than a mile of shelves, this place is like a treasure hunt. Most books are $1-$3, so it’s a great place to stock up on reads. They rescue books that might have been thrown away, so you’ll find everything from kids’ picture books to classic sci-fi and thrillers. The owners are passionate about giving books a second life and creating a space for readers of all ages. Check their website for hours and upcoming pop-up events.

3. Sam’s Books

Sam’s Books in the Oldsmar Flea Market is a cute, retro, and inexpensive treasure trove for bookworms. Open Fridays, Saturdays, and Sundays, this used bookstore has been around for over 25 years. They specialize in children’s books but have a wide range of genres, from fiction to history. The owner is super nice and loves helping you find the perfect book. Prices are low, so you can leave with a stack of books and not break the bank. Contact them on the website to check book availability or to schedule a visit.

4. Tampa Antiques and Books

Tampa Antiques and Books is old, historic and cozy. It’s like stepping back in time. Located in an adobe style house this shop combines used books with antique furniture and collectibles. You’ll find classic novels, art books and historical reads all neatly organized. The owner is knowledgeable and will help you find something special. It’s a great place to browse for hours if you love the smell of old books. Their website has more info on their inventory and hours.

5. Back in the Day Books

Back in the Day Books in Tampa is nostalgic, organized and inviting. Perfect for those who love vintage reads. This shop focuses on used and collectible books including rare novels, biographies and Florida history titles. The wooden shelves are packed with treasures and the staff will recommend books based on your interests. It’s a quiet place to get lost in a good story. Their website has a peek into their inventory and contact info for book inquiries.

6. The Far Forest

The Far Forest in Seminole Heights is enchanting, vintage, and peaceful. It’s like a fairy tale. This small shop specializes in antique and collectible books, including first editions and beautifully illustrated classics. The wooden shelves and cozy decor will make you lose track of time. The staff is super helpful and loves to talk about books. It’s a great place to find a unique gift or a rare book for your collection. Check their website for hours and events.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I sell or trade books at these bookstores?

Yes, many of these bookstores, like Mojo Books & Records and The Book Rescuers, will buy or trade books. Check their websites before you go to buy hours and policies.

Are these bookstores good for children’s books?

Yes! Sam’s Books has a huge selection of children’s books, but The Book Rescuers and Back in the Day Books have great kids’ books too.

Do these bookstores have online shopping?

Some, like Mojo Books & Records and Back in the Day Books, have online shopping on their websites. Others, like Sam’s Books, will let you contact them to check availability or order.
